Code P1476 MINI Description

The P1476 MINI code indicates a problem with the Leakage Diagnostic Pump Clamped Tube in the vehicle's evaporative emission control system. This system is responsible for capturing and storing fuel vapors to prevent them from escaping into the atmosphere. The clamped tube is a crucial component that helps maintain the system's integrity by ensuring a tight seal.

Common Causes of P1476 MINI

  1. Loose or damaged clamps securing the tube
  2. Cracked or deteriorating tube material
  3. Incorrect installation of the tube
  4. Debris or blockages in the tube
  5. Corrosion or rust affecting the tube

Symptoms of P1476 MINI

  1. Check engine light is illuminated
  2. Fuel smell inside or outside the vehicle
  3. Decreased fuel efficiency
  4. Hissing or hissing sounds coming from the evaporative emission system
  5. Difficulty starting the engine

How to Fix P1476 MINI

  1. Diagnose the issue using a scan tool to confirm the P1476 code and visually inspect the clamped tube for damage or leaks.
  2. Replace any damaged or deteriorated clamps securing the tube.
  3. Inspect the tube for cracks or leaks and replace it if necessary.
  4. Clear the diagnostic trouble codes and perform a test to ensure the issue has been resolved.
  5. Perform a smoke test to check for any additional leaks in the evaporative emission system.

Cost to Fix P1476 MINI

The cost of repairing a Leakage Diagnostic Pump Clamped Tube can vary depending on the extent of the damage and the specific components that need to be replaced. On average, the parts for this repair may cost anywhere from $50 to $200, while the labor cost can range from $100 to $300. Overall, the total repair cost could be between $150 and $500. It's important to note that these are rough estimates and actual costs may vary based on the factors mentioned earlier.
